Novità

Per gli esperti di listati

solare

Advanced Member >PLATINUM<
Ciao, chiedo se possibile modificare questo listato "Lottodesk" affinchè possa funzionare con spaziometria
mostra la frequenza dei 90 nr simpatici se possibile fare in modo che la frequenza venga ordinata dal > al <.
è anche la possibilità di selezionare le ruote

Codice:
Sub main()
Dim dt(10)
Dim es(2,90)

num=InputBox("Inserisci il numero ",,3)

For n= EstrazioneIni To EstrazioneFin-1

        If Posizione(n,6,num)>0 Then
            For i = 1 To 5
                es(1,Estratto(n-1,6,i))=es(1,Estratto(n-1,6,i))+1
            Next
        End If
        If Posizione(n,7,num)>0 Then
            For i = 1 To 5
                es(2,Estratto(n-1,7,i))=es(2,Estratto(n-1,7,i))+1
            Next
        End If
Next
    Scrivi "Ciclo Numero " & "ruota NAPOLI " & "NUMERO " &num
    For fin=1 To 90
        If es(1,fin)>15 Then Scrivi "(" & fin & ")" & "Volte >>"  & es(1,fin)
    Next

    Scrivi "Ciclo Numero " & "ruota PALERMO " & "NUMERO " &num
    For fin=1 To 90
        If es(2,fin)>15 Then Scrivi "(" & fin & ")" & "Volte >>"  & es(2,fin)
    Next
End Sub
 
Ultima modifica:

claudio8

Premium Member
Solare, lo script funziona anche su SPMT.
Spiega bene cosa intendi x Simpatici perchè nello script vengono considerati i numeri precedenti alla spia num.

Comunque sul forum ci sono decine di script sui frequenti dopo la spia.
 

solare

Advanced Member >PLATINUM<
Ciao Claudio8, lo script deve restare così com'è per quanto riguarda la ricerca
l'unica cosa è riuscire ad avere la possibilità di selezionare le ruote.
 

Enplein

Super Member >PLATINUM<
Codice:
Sub Main()
   Dim dt(10)
   Dim es(2,90)
   num = InputBox("Inserisci il numero ",,3)
   r1 = InputBox("Inserisci la 1a ruota ",,6)
   r2 = InputBox("Inserisci la 2a ruota ",,7)
   For n = EstrazioneIni To EstrazioneFin - 1
      If Posizione(n,r1,num) > 0 Then
         For i = 1 To 5
            es(1,Estratto(n - 1,r1,i)) = es(1,Estratto(n - 1,r1,i)) + 1
         Next
      End If
      If Posizione(n,r2,num) > 0 Then
         For i = 1 To 5
            es(2,Estratto(n - 1,r2,i)) = es(2,Estratto(n - 1,r2,i)) + 1
         Next
      End If
   Next
   Scrivi "Ciclo Numero " & Format2(num) & "  Ruota " & NomeRuota(r1),1
   For fin = 1 To 90
      If es(1,fin) > 15 Then Scrivi "(" & fin & ")" & "Volte >>" & es(1,fin)
   Next
   Scrivi
   Scrivi "Ciclo Numero " & Format2(num) & "  Ruota " & NomeRuota(r2),1
   For fin = 1 To 90
      If es(2,fin) > 15 Then Scrivi "(" & fin & ")" & "Volte >>" & es(2,fin)
   Next
End Sub

Enplein.
 

claudio8

Premium Member
Solare,
l'impostazione dello script non dà la possibilità di ordinare la matrice dai + al - freq. ( non intendo modificarlo allo scopo perchè e male impostato per la tua esigenza)
Ti inserisco il tuo script con la possibilità di scegliere tutte le ruote che vuoi Tutte esclusa.

Ciapa

Codice:
Sub Main
    'Dim dt(10)
    Dim es(2,90)
    ReDim aRuote(12)
    Dim num,r,n,fin
    num = InputBox("Inserisci il numero ",,3)
    If ScegliRuote(aRuote) > 0 Then
        For r = 1 To UBound(aRuote)
            If aRuote(r) <> 11 Then
                For n = EstrazioneIni To EstrazioneFin - 1
                    If Posizione(n,aRuote(r),num) > 0 Then
                        For i = 1 To 5
                            es(1,Estratto(n - 1,aRuote(r),i)) = es(1,Estratto(n - 1,aRuote(r),i)) + 1
                        Next
                    End If
                Next
                Scrivi " Scrivo la matrice 'es' che come vedi è impostata in orizzontale quindi non ordinabile " ' da remmare
                ScriviMatrice es ' da remmare
                Scrivi "Ciclo sulla ruota di " & SiglaRuota(aRuote(r)) & " del NUMERO " & num
                For fin = 1 To 90
                    If es(1,fin) > 15 Then Scrivi " Il " & Format2(fin) & " è presente " & es(1,fin) & " Volte "
                Next
            End If
        Erase es  
        Next
    End If
End Sub
un saluto
 

Ultima estrazione Lotto

  • Estrazione del lotto
    giovedì 28 marzo 2024
    Bari
    49
    73
    67
    86
    19
    Cagliari
    64
    36
    37
    02
    04
    Firenze
    66
    27
    44
    90
    17
    Genova
    09
    44
    78
    85
    19
    Milano
    70
    14
    47
    38
    27
    Napoli
    80
    29
    28
    45
    39
    Palermo
    54
    59
    78
    47
    62
    Roma
    17
    22
    49
    52
    88
    Torino
    71
    35
    75
    74
    60
    Venezia
    40
    84
    02
    63
    29
    Nazionale
    08
    13
    44
    69
    85
    Estrazione Simbolotto
    Firenze
    06
    35
    16
    18
    05

Ultimi Messaggi

Alto